Suburb
is a neighbourhood of , in the district of . , possibly from the Gaelic for "hill of thorns", is a housing area, dating from the 1950s and built by the local council, on the hills above Port Glasgow, just to the south of the A761 road to Kilmacolm. is situated 2½ miles north of Burnbank Bridge.
